Watch Turnstile Debut ‘I Care’ and ‘Dull’ on ‘Fallon’


Turnstile stopped by The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on last night (June 3), debuting two songs from their new album Never Enough, which is out in a couple of days. Watch them rip through ‘I Care’ and ‘Dull’ below.

Never Enough is the long-awaited follow-up to the hardcore band’s 2021 breakthrough Glow On, which they promoted on Fallon with a performance of ‘Blackout’. So far, they’ve teased the new LP with the singles ‘Look Out For Me’, ‘Seein’ Stars’, and ‘Birds’.
